Output 84ef36e867717031fa8817a3958fd6194385c4c1002c84f049d4e7c98e68a264:0

value
535813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89874a91bee2b1879240c823f255cc8c0c0cd6d3 OP_EQUALVERIFY OP_CHECKSIG
address
1DYBeV5fBByq57ToZgM8mv3MZ3fAsBePUh
transaction
84ef36e867717031fa8817a3958fd6194385c4c1002c84f049d4e7c98e68a264
spent
true